National Tourism Post COVID-19, | The Recovery Process for Sustaining and Growth of Pakistan’s Economy.

Written by: Moazzam Ali Khan Former Chairman Pakistan Hotel Association

The COVID-19 pandemic is a global crisis without a modern equivalence. The lack of precedent of uncertainty, the lives of each of us have impacted across the world. The economic experts explain why the public and private sectors had already started getting the strains way before the World Health Organization declared on March 11, 2020, this alarming situation as PANDEMIC.

The actions taken by the respective governments, public sector, and the private sector will set a foundation for any such eventualities in the future and will at the same time boost many of these stakeholders to recover and eventually sustain the oncoming growth process.

This pandemic will give more opportunities as many of world-renowned financial companies predict new changed markets for businesses will surface up for sectors of trade and business, including tourism.

Soon with the curative process of COVID-19, the commercial aviation industry will have to resume its business with the conditions to adhere to stricter rules and travel restrictions enforced by almost all the countries. There is a possibility of increased fares/ tariff for all the commercial aviation operators, to circumvent the imposed restrictions of social distancing, sanitization of all areas of operation including the aircraft. Coming back 100% normalcy will take a while, perhaps not before the end of the year 2020 or it may go even beyond this time frame.

The entire world is currently engaged in bringing their respective country back to normalcy, for which all efforts are being implemented. The developed countries have also extended soft interest loans, to all the small, medium, and big size business houses so that they can sustain themselves for the business activities and keep their employees on their payroll.

All the interlinked stakeholders involved in the recovery and growth of the Tourism industry,   vis-a’-vis Commercial Aviation, Hotels and Tours Operators need to develop their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s)  and swiftly implement the same for the success of their growth and for sustaining the ongoing business. These SOPs will define their standards under the prevailing condition for e.g cleaning and sanitizing all public areas, restaurants, public toilets, guest rooms, use of mask and gloves by the operational staff, etc. The same needs to be evolved and implemented by all the stakeholders of the Tourism industry.

Due to the current deteriorating situation of Pakistan’s economy, more so due to the effect of COVID-19, all stakeholders more specifically from the Tourism industry needs to promote Pakistan in a better way, perhaps highlighting their advertising with the care and importance for disinfecting all the areas of Hotel, rooms, restaurants, etc. A lot of marketing efforts will be needed to tap international tourists.

With China’s lockdown over, travel has already restarted. China’s experience as consumer confidence in travel growth can help businesses in other parts of the world will surely navigate the next level of normalcy. In my opinion, this was a very swift, smart, and robust initiative taken by China, which soon will be witnessed by all of us. It will be a source of competitive agility and growth. I am sure China’s experience can shed light on what other countries can do, especially Pakistan being a close ally of China can immensely benefit their experience.

At present, travel is entirely domestic, international borders are closed. Like other countries, China has also imposed 14 days quarantine for international travelers (either in-home or in government facilities), for every person coming from overseas. The international flights have been capped at one a week per airline and country, more than a 90 % drop in seat capacity from a pre-crisis level. Hotel occupancy and domestic flight capacity are growing gradually. The travelers are still little cautious but gaining confidence and very soon they will make a breakthrough.

The travelers’ demographic and the overall economic spending pattern is also being monitored by the concerned department to review for future actions. For your information, the overall spending is not more than CNY 10,000 at an average.

Now the role of the private sector Hotel and Tour operators are equally important for their share in the process of the recovery of the business, a few recommendations for their review as below:

  • Pricing your product will be a prime ingredient of your business, not very exorbitantly high nor very low, the margin of profit to be evaluated fairly.
  • Group bookings mean volume, to be given preferential pricing.
  • Innovative marketing strategies to be activated to attract tourists, business travelers, and others. All gloomy marketing promotions to be encouraged for implementation. Not every trick and marketing tactic will work it need constant monitoring. But the marketing team to be encouraged to make mistakes. Find new solutions to diversify the source market. The marketing should not forget to tap the domestic in and out bond travelers.
  • The consumer has changed their behavior and lifestyle due to the COVID-19 pandemic, they have become very sensitive for hygiene/sanitizing and social distancing, hence due cognizance to be taken. Hence it is recommended, a proper advertising campaign is initiated to gain the confidence of the product and the available protective services.

Tourism is a highly labor-intense industry, in Pakistan and globally. It provides huge job opportunities for the masses, to revive this industry, it is pertinent that the government should support businesses morally and initiate the reforms as recommended time and again for a prosperous PAKISTAN.
